AtkinsRéalis, Balfour Beatty and Egis Road Operations UK are part of a consortium, creating Connect Plus Services, a unique partnership with a collective strength in highways asset care from finance, through to design, build, maintenance as well as day to day operation.

As part of our 30-year remit to manage and improve the capital's orbital motorway network, we deliver major improvement projects, such as widening 38 miles of the M25, refurbishing tunnels and bridges, and installing hundreds of variable messaging signs and gantries, helping to maximise the use of the network and deliver more reliable journeys.

Connect Plus services are seeking to appoint a Street Lighting Engineer to join our team on the M25 DBFO project. This position involves undertaking design projects, managing timelines and external consultants, and ensuring effective communication among team members, the supply chain and internal and external stakeholders.

Your Purpose:

  • Assist in planning, organizing, and overseeing design projects from concept to completion, ensuring they are delivered on time and within budget.
  • Undertaking lighting designs using Lighting Reality design or similar software.
  • Prepare and maintain design documentation, including project briefs, timelines, and works information. Ensure all files are organized and accessible.
  • Management of external consultants undertaking designs.
  • Review design outputs for accuracy and consistency, ensuring they align with project goals, the DMRB and relevant standards.
  • Collect and organize feedback from the supply chain, client, and internal teams, ensuring it is communicated effectively.
  • Stay updated on the DMRB and Change in Standards and best practices, sharing insights with the team to achieve solutions.
